Explain the importance of the nitrogen base and their role in preserving the code
sukhopar [10]

Ans.

Genetic codes provide information for the protein synthesis as each code specifically codes a particular amino acid that gets joined in polypeptide chain during the process of translation.

Each genetic code is three letter code, made up of three nitrogenous bases. There are four different bases in DNA or RNA that make sixty four codes with different combinations, out of which sixty one code for amino acids and three act as stop codons.

Thus, nitrogenous bases are important in preserving the genetic codes.
